Manipur Tense: Prohibitory Orders in 5 Districts, Internet Cut After Meitei Leader's Arrest
Tensions remain high in Manipur following the arrest of a Meitei outfit Arambai Tenggol leader. Prohibitory orders under BNSS Section 163, banning assembly of five or more people and carrying weapons, are imposed in five Imphal valley districts: Imphal West, Imphal East, Thoubal, Bishnupur, and Kakching. Internet services are suspended. Protests saw torched tyres, clashes with security, a bus set on fire, and gheraoing of Imphal airport. Security is enhanced around Raj Bhavan.
Colombian Presidential Hopeful Miguel Uribe Critically Wounded in Campaign Rally Shooting
Colombian Senator Miguel Uribe Turbay, a 39-year-old conservative presidential candidate for the 2026 election, was shot and critically wounded during a campaign rally in Bogota's Fontibon neighborhood. Assailants shot him from behind. He is undergoing neurosurgical procedures. A 15-year-old was arrested with a firearm. The attack, condemned internationally, prompted President Petro to cancel a trip. Uribe Turbay's mother was killed in 1991 by Pablo Escobar's cartel.
Trump Deploys National Guard to LA Over Immigration Protests, Clashes with Governor Newsom
President Donald Trump deployed 2,000 California National Guard troops to Los Angeles to quell protests against immigration enforcement, overriding Governor Gavin Newsom's objections. Clashes erupted between demonstrators and Border Patrol personnel in Paramount, involving tear gas and flash-bangs. The White House cited "lawlessness," while Newsom called the deployment "purposefully inflammatory." The protests followed ICE operations that resulted in 118 arrests, part of Trump's push for mass deportations.
PM Modi: NDA Redefined Women-Led Development in 11 Years, Cites Key Schemes
Prime Minister Narendra Modi stated that the NDA government has redefined women-led development over its 11 years in power. He highlighted women's excellence in sectors like science, sports, and armed forces. Modi cited welfare schemes like Swachh Bharat, Jan Dhan, Ujjwala Yojana, MUDRA loans, PM Awas Yojana, and Beti Bachao Beti Padhao as empowering women, noting declines in maternal mortality and increased tap water connections and cooking gas access.
FPIs Pull Rs 8,749 Crore from Indian Equities in June Amid Global Tensions
Foreign Portfolio Investors (FPIs) turned net sellers, withdrawing Rs 8,749 crore from Indian equities in June's first week, contrasting with May's Rs 19,860 crore investment. This outflow, attributed to US-China trade tensions, rising US bond yields, and an Adani Group investigation, brings the 2025 total FPI withdrawal to Rs 1.01 lakh crore. FPIs also pulled Rs 6,709 crore from debt general limit and Rs 5,974 crore from debt voluntary retention.
